> What I want to ask is that 'Release2' is the complete OS and after
> installation we can use 'yum update'. So at first, is it enough (as I
> am not going to download the complete set of 7 CDs)?

the LiveCD will not install the operating system.   It is purely for 
demo or diagnostic purposes.


use the network installer iso if you want a single CD install.  
otherwise, you need most of the 7 CDs to install a typical selection of 
packages, or the DVD.
